How do I remove a family member from my card?

I would like to remove a family member from my Apple Master Card. How do I do this?

>>How to remove a participant from your Apple Card Family account


  1. On your iPhone, open the Wallet app and tap Apple Card.
  2. Tap the More button , then tap Card Details .
  3. Tap the participant that you want to remove.
  4. Scroll down and tap Stop Sharing, then confirm.


On your iPad, open the Settings app > Wallet & Apple Pay > Apple Card > Info tab. Tap the participant that you want to remove, tap Stop Sharing, then tap Confirm.


When you remove a participant from your shared Apple Card account, that participant can no longer spend on your Apple Card.1 Any transactions the participant attempts will be automatically declined. Removing a participant does not close your shared Apple Card account. The account owner or co-owners are still responsible for the balance and payments after a participant is removed.


An account co-owner can't be removed. If you don't want to be account co-owners with someone else, you need to close your shared Apple Card account and open a new Apple Card account. When a shared Apple Card account is closed, both co-owners are responsible for all outstanding balances on the account until they're paid in full.<<
